#include <bits/stdc++.h>
using namespace std;
 
#define MAXN 100005
 
static int D[MAXN], E[MAXN];
 
int findSample(int n, int c[], int h[], int p[])
{
    for (int i=0;i<n;i++) D[i] = c[i];
    for (int i=n;--i;){
        int t = h[i];
        if (p[i] == 0){
            D[t] += E[i];
            E[t] = max(E[t] + D[i], E[t] + E[i]);
        }else if (p[i] == 1){
            D[t] = max(D[t] + D[i], max(D[t] + E[i], E[t] + D[i]));
            E[t] += E[i];
        }else{
            D[t] = max(D[t] + E[i], E[t] + D[i]);
            E[t] += E[i];
        }
    }
    return max(D[0], E[0]);
}
